Where does this role fit in?

As Packaging Artworker you are responsible for the creation of day-to-day artwork following the briefing, production, sampling and approval processes.

You are accountable for your own workload, managing jobs through to completion, working with the Packaging Design Manager you help manage the day-to-day artwork output.

You create commercial designs for use across all packaging areas including constructional and graphical elements. You support all areas of packaging as required; including women's, men’s, kids & home. You work closely with the brand guidelines to deliver commercial design solutions that meet the brief requirements.

Requirements

What can you bring to the table?

Just have a look below, if this sounds like you it’s definitely worth putting yourself forward:

  • Previous packaging design role with at least 3 years experience (retail / fashion preferable)
  • Packaging Design/Graphic Design related degree or equivalent

 

Have a portfolio which demonstrates:

  • Well rounded packaging design experience across multiple areas (ideally in a fashion or homeware environment)
  • Excellent knowledge of both constructional and graphical design
  • Creative thinking
  • Excellent knowledge of end-to-end design to print processes
  • Working knowledge of design briefs
  • Brand guidelines experience
  • High level of technical proficiency in Mac OS and Adobe CC software – with a focus on Illustrator
  • Excellent understanding of colour theory
  • Excellent working knowledge of packaging materials including papers/cards and fabrics
  • Excellent understanding of typography
  • Excellent communication, interpersonal and team skills
  • Collaborative; ability to develop strong relationships with suppliers and company departments
